sql >> Databáze >  >> RDS >> Oracle

Odeberte záhlaví sloupce do výstupního textového souboru

SQLPLUS COMMAND Přeskočeno:nastavit kurz mimo

Tato zpráva je pravděpodobně způsobena tím, že ji nespouštíte prostřednictvím SQL*Plus , ale nějaký nástroj založený na GUI. Používáte příkaz SQLPlus v SQL Developer. Ne všechny příkazy SQL*Plus zaručeně fungují s SQL Developer .

Navrhoval bych, abyste skript spustili v SQLPlus a neviděli byste žádné problémy.

Potřebujete:

SET HEADING OFF

Toto nebude obsahovat záhlaví sloupců ve výstupu.

Případně můžete také provést toto:

SET PAGESIZE 0

Použití SQL Developer verze 3.2.20.10 :

spool ON
spool D:\test.txt
SET heading OFF
SELECT ename FROM emp;
spool off

Soubor pro zařazování byl vytvořen bez problémů:

> set heading OFF
> SELECT ename FROM emp
SMITH      
ALLEN      
WARD       
JONES      
MARTIN     
BLAKE      
CLARK      
SCOTT      
KING       
TURNER     
ADAMS      
JAMES      
FORD       
MILLER     

 14 rows selected 


  1. Vyberte posledních N řádků z MySQL

  2. Operace SQL Server CRUD

  3. Jaké jsou rozdíly mezi SQL a MySQL

  4. Jak vytvořit trasování SQL pro zachycení událostí serveru SQL